How to Choose the Right Pixel 11 Pro Fold Case
With the Google Pixel 11 Pro Fold, protection is more than just about looks—it's about safeguarding a pricey, cutting-edge device with unique needs due to its folding design. The fold mechanism is particularly vulnerable to damage, so choosing a case that accounts for hinge coverage and daily wear is key. Decide first if you prioritize drop protection, a slim profile, or features like MagSafe compatibility. Foldable phones can be bulkier once cased, so think about bag and pocket fit as well.
Who Should Buy Each Type of Pixel 11 Pro Fold Case?
- Minimalist Users: Prefer to keep the phone's slim feel? The Mous Super Thin Aramid Fibre Cover balances protection with a barely-there profile, ideal for careful owners or those who dislike bulk.
- Everyday Protection Seekers: Need something safe for daily bumps and scrapes? Cases like the Spigen Slim Armor Pro Magfit or the OtterBox Lumen Series offer reinforced edges and shock resistance without feeling unwieldy, and both have strong brand reputations for durability.
- Showcasing Your Fold: Prefer people see the phone itself? Clear and translucent options, including the FNTCASE Clear Case and its Translucent Hinge Protection variant, protect while letting the device’s finish and fold design remain visible.
- MagSafe and Charging Addicts: If you rely on wireless accessories, cases with MagSafe compatibility (such as select Mous, FNTCASE, and Hensinple models) are a must—just be aware that some third-party chargers may not grip as firmly due to case thickness.
- Hinge-Focused: Want extra peace of mind about the most fragile part? Look for cases that specifically mention hinge protection (like certain FNTCASE and OWKEY versions), especially if you tend to drop or toss your phone into bags.
Trade-offs, Limitations, and Alternatives
Bulkier cases might offer the best drop resistance, but they'll make your slim foldable feel much less pocket-friendly. Super-thin cases are excellent if you handle your phone carefully, but don’t expect them to save your phone from major drops. Transparent and translucent cases can yellow or scratch over time, which is common for clear plastics.
If you want ultimate ruggedness, compare with Samsung’s Z Fold series case options—they have broader third-party support and typically offer more variety, especially for those seeking ultra-heavy-duty styles. Unfortunately, Pixel foldables still have fewer tailored choices than Samsung or iPhone foldables, so flexibility in style, color, or budget is limited.
